Ocelot/HyPE: Optimized Data Processing on Heterogeneous Hardware

Summary: Proposes Ocelot/HyPE, a hardware-oblivious data processing engine paired with a learning-based optimizer for heterogeneous hardware. Demonstrates adaptive DBMS capable of automatic operator placement across accelerators, easing code maintenance while optimizing runtimes. (summarized by gpt-5-nano on Feb 09 2026)
